If you’re a chocolate lover, this recipe is for you 🤎 These triple chocolate cookies are rich, soft, and loaded with chocolate in every bite. Crispy on the edges, gooey in the centre, basically everything you want in a cookie.

Ingredients
😍¾ cup butter (150g)
😍¾ cup brown sugar
😍2 tbsp castor sugar
😍3 tbsp curd
😍1+1/2 cup all purpose flour
😍¼ cup cocoa powder
😍1 tsp cornflour
😍¼ tsp baking soda
😍½ tsp baking powder
😍⅓ cup chocolate callets (dark and milk)
😍12 milk chocolate chunks

Instructions
1. Preheat the oven to 180°C. Lightly grease a lunchbox.
2. In a bowl, add butter and both the sugars. Whisk or beat until the mixture looks creamy and slightly lighter in colour.
3. Mix in the curd and combine until the mixture looks smooth and slightly glossy. This step helps loosen the batter and adds softness.
4. Add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ture. Using a spatula, gently fold everything together until a soft dough forms. Don’t overmix, stop as soon as no dry flour is visible.
5. Fold in the chocolate callets, distributing them evenly through the dough.
6. ⁠Divide the dough into 12 small round balls and stuff each one with a large chocolate chunk.
7. Arrange them in the lunchbox and freeze for 15 minutes. Bake for 16-18 minutes. The edges should look set and slightly golden, while the center should still look soft and underbaked.
8. Let it sit for 5–10 minutes after baking. Scoop it out with a spoon and enjoy that soft, melty center.
